SpaceWorks Announces First e-Marketplace Client: MedCenterDirect.com
Rockville, MD -- May 9, 2000 -- SpaceWorks, Inc. ®, the leading business-to- business sell-side Web commerce software company, today announced its first client in the rapidly growing e-Marketplace sector. MedCenterDirect.com, a newly launched B2B medical e-Marketplace, has licensed SpaceWorks OrderManager ® as the e-Commerce engine for its Web-based medical products distribution channel and SpaceWorks IntegrationManager to facilitate real-time links to its back-end system. SpaceWorks rapidly launched the MedCenterDirect e-Marketplace, with an implementation time of sixty days. SpaceWorks also plans to offer other companion modules in the SpaceWorks Web BusinessManager Suite, including ServiceManager, AuctionManager and MarketingManager.These applications will expand the functionality of the MedCenterDirect OrderManager implementation by adding more features and capabilities to the site.
Using SpaceWorks OrderManager, a customer can provide Authorized buyers with the ability to buy products over the Web on a 24x7 basis. Using a browser, these business users can view information from a comprehensive database of products, place real-time orders, check up-to- the-minute inventory availability, track immediate order status, and verify shipments around the clock.
The SpaceWorks IntegrationManager application provides seamless, XML-based links to the back- end system where the key product and account databases are stored. IntegrationManager also will create transparent connections to buyers' own internal purchasing systems, so orders do not need re-keying.
With SpaceWorks ServiceManager, buyers will be able to use e-mail, chat sessions and voice over the Web to seek customer service. Such users also will be able to answer their own questions about products through a comprehensive, self-help database. SpaceWorks AuctionManager will give buyers the ability to bid for selected products in a user-friendly auction environment, participating in dynamic, user-driven pricing. Finally, MarketingManager will empower MedCenterDirect to deploy tailored B2B marketing tactics ranging from customer- specific promotions to broader up-selling and cross-selling - to ensure a truly unique buying experience that simultaneously drives increased sales.

About SpaceWorks SpaceWorks, Inc.® drives billions in B2B revenue today for Global 2000 manufacturers, distributors and supplier-driven marketplaces. SpaceWorks industrial-strength application, the Web BusinessManager Suite, automates all the mission-critical activities involved in B2B selling, including ordering, marketing, billing and more. The solution integrates with back-end systems, e-Marketplaces and customer procurement networks to enable real-time, revenue-generating transactions. SpaceWorks clients include Avaya, BF Goodrich, GE Aircraft Engines, and Maytag Corporation, among others. Alliance partners include PricewaterhouseCoopers, webMethods, Commerce One and more.
